Course introduction
The student should be shown examples of mathematical modeling in science and engineering within the topics of this course (see below) and should learn to analyze and solve these problems numerically.

Expected learning outcome
At the end of the course the student will be able to:
- identify and apply mathematical models and concepts to explain, analyse and estimate physical and technical problems
- correctly apply mathematical models to explain and predict the behaviour of the modelled system
- compare different mathematical models and methods, and discuss their advantages and disadvantages
- solve mathematical problems using numerical methods, including planning and completing of the numerical calculations
- analyze and assess the result of a numerical calculation in relation to the original problem, including identification and estimation of possible sources of error

Subject overview
- solution of linear and nonlinear systems of equations
- numerical integration and differentiation
- simple integral and ordinary differential equations
- estimation of error for iterative methods and discretization methods
